Scientists warn that climate change presents an existential threat to agricultural communities globally. Researchers involved in an IEA initiative, part of the National Research Council, highlight that increasing temperatures, shifting rainfall patterns, and more extreme weather will fundamentally alter crop cultivation locations and methods. The most vulnerable and impoverished agricultural communities will bear the brunt of these changes.
This stark forecast is based on a new "map" tool developed by the IEA in collaboration with the UK's Centre for Economic Policy Research and the UK Foreign Office. This tool, accurate to within approximately 9-10 kilometers, illustrates how the agricultural utility of specific areas will change over time. Already, 15% of the global population resides in territories where agricultural potential has decreased by 5% since the turn of the century. Projections suggest that if global temperatures rise by 2.1 degrees Celsius by mid-century, half the world's population could face similar conditions.
The Climate-Induced Agricultural Decline Index (CADI) uses dozens of algorithms, drawing on data from organizations like the UN's Food and Agriculture Organization and the European Copernicus program. The index visualizes these changes on a map, with areas experiencing the greatest declines in agricultural capacity highlighted in red. Significant losses are projected for regions including India, Southeast Asia, eastern China, North Africa, the central United States, and large parts of Brazil. Europe also shows considerable red, with the Balkans, Hungary, Austria, the Italian Adriatic coast, much of France, Denmark, and central Spain particularly affected.
While rising temperatures might increase agricultural utility in some previously less favorable regions, such as Scotland, the Alps, and northern Scandinavia, these potential gains are unlikely to compensate for the widespread losses across the continent. Poland, in comparison to the rest of Europe, does not appear to be the worst affected, but this offers little comfort amidst the broader challenges.
